Radar Altimeter Market Overview:

A radar altimeter is also called a radio altimeter (RALT), electronic altimeter, reflection altimeter. It is used to measure altitude above the terrain and beneath an aircraft or spacecraft. A radio altimeter is an airborne electronic device, which is capable of measuring the height of the aircraft. It is suitable device to measure the absolute altitude of the spacecraft or aircraft above the terrain, which is completed by transmitting, receiving and processing a radio into analog voltage proportional to the height.

Previously, radio altimeters have determined altitude by measuring the time between transmission of a radio signal between the aircraft and the reflected signal. Currently, Modern systems are transforming the way of measurement way. An introduction of innovative measurement system of phase between the transmitted and reflected signal are expected to drive the market growth.

Radar Altimeter Market Dynamics:

The usages of radio altimeter are an integral part for both the function of ground proximity warning systems and operation of aircraft, where it is used to determine the position of the aircraft in relation to the applicable decision height. The growth of the radar altimeters market is primarily driven by its growing adoption in civil and military aviation applications. Increasing adoption of radar altimeters by remote sensing scientists for in various geomorphologic studies, rising use of safety and security measures in aerospace and defence industry, high spending on defence industry by various governments across the region and rising demand for military and commercial aircrafts are expected to improve growth of the market during the forecast period.

Radar altimeter provides some benefits such as indication of accurate height and high reliability which are ultimately propelling the growth of the market. An increase in the air passenger traffics are growing rapidly because of the consumer spending, which is fueled by modern lifestyle and travel time saving. demand for commercial aircrafts, adoption of radar altimeter by adventure sports, mountaineers and sky divers are expected to boost the market growth in the near future. On the other hand, possibility of technical failure in radar altimeters because of the harsh weather condition like rain and snow and high cost of the radar altimeter are limiting the growth of the radar altimeter market.

Radar Altimeter Market Segment Analysis:

By application, the global radar altimeter market is segmented into civil aviation applications and military aviation applications. The Civil aviation application segment held the dominant position in 2025. A growing adoption of radar altimeters in commercial aircrafts for landing purpose particularly for automatic landings and in low-visibility conditions to allow the autopilot to begin the flare maneuver are some of the prominent factors, which are increasing demand for radar altimeter. In commercial aircrafts, radar altimeters give the altitude readings up to 760 m above the ground level.

Also, rising adoption of radar altimeters to give warning to pilot if the aircraft is descending too quickly or flying too low is expected to boost the growth of the market. However, military aviation application is expected to contribute more than 45% share in the market during the forecast period. An increasing adoption of radar altimeters in military aircrafts to take off moderately low over the sea and the land to avoid radar detection is attributed to the growth of the market. In addition, rising use of radar altimeters in military aircrafts during war to find the exact location of enemy’s aircraft and in naval operation to find the suspicious submarine or ship is impelling the growth of radar altimeter market.

Recent Industry Developments

Exact Date Company Development Impact
18 March 2026 Honeywell International Inc. Honeywell confirmed that its upcoming Aerospace spinoff, set for Q3 2026, will prioritize radar altimeter integration within its $6.8 billion Electronic Solutions segment. The move creates a pure-play aerospace leader capable of faster R&D cycles for 5G-resilient altimetry.
06 January 2026 Collins Aerospace Collins Aerospace secured a $438 million FAA contract to replace legacy radar infrastructure with next-generation cooperative systems. This modernizes the National Airspace System, significantly increasing demand for high-precision tracking at low altitudes.
18 December 2025 Leonardo S.p.A. Leonardo signed a contract with TELEDIFE for the delivery of four next-generation radars using AESA GaN technology for the Michelangelo Dome system. It establishes Italy as a European leader in integrated ballistic defense and high-efficiency radar sensors.
03 October 2025 Thales Group Thales announced the full series production of its Ground Fire radar, with initial deliveries to French forces scheduled for early 2026. This triples Thales' radar production capacity to meet rising European sovereign air defense needs.
27 May 2025 Honeywell International Inc. Honeywell was selected to supply Next Generation APN-209 radar altimeters for Japan’s CH-47F heavy-lift helicopter program. The contract solidifies Honeywell's market share in the APAC region through defense modernization partnerships.
